How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Indian Hills?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Indian Hills Studio Apartments | $1,447 | $860 | $2,535 |
Indian Hills 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,880 | $892 | $4,794 |
Indian Hills 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,741 | $1,250 | $7,430 |
Indian Hills 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,686 | $1,688 | $4,345 |
Indian Hills 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,695 | $2,695 | $2,695 |
